    <dct:description>&lt;p&gt;This research deals with the performance assessment and upgrading of Walga micro hydro&lt;br&gt; power plant owned by government and fitted with cross flow turbine. Walga site is located in&lt;br&gt; Oromia Regional State, South West Shoa zone, Wonchi Woreda Azer_Keransa Kebele. Walga&lt;br&gt; site is located in a remote area. Currently, even though the village has the opportunity to get&lt;br&gt; power from micro hydro power plant that was installed in 2014 by the Ministry of Water,&lt;br&gt; Irrigation and Electricity, still the plant lacks reliability, sustainability and safety problems. The&lt;br&gt; key reasons for the performance assessment and up grading of the existing Walga micro hydro&lt;br&gt; power station were to know the efficiencies (turbine and unit efficiencies) and to determine the&lt;br&gt; electrical power output of the plant. And also to know the power demand gap between supply&lt;br&gt; side from the existing micro hydro power generator and demand side obtained from the village&lt;br&gt; power demand assessment during the field survey. Therefore, performance assessment and&lt;br&gt; testing, power need assessment of the community, determination of the power gap between the&lt;br&gt; supply side from the existing Walga micro hydro power station and demand side were the&lt;br&gt; purpose of this thesis work.&lt;br&gt; In this study, performance assessment of existing Walga micro hydro power station was carried&lt;br&gt; out and performance indicators were identified. Based on the performance test results and the&lt;br&gt; village power demand assessment findings, the power demand gap of Walga village was known.,&lt;br&gt; Two options were proposed to meet the power demand gap of the village. The first option is&lt;br&gt; developing a PV/micro hydro hybrid power supply system and the second option is developing&lt;br&gt; micro hydro resource existing at the site&lt;/p&gt;</dct:description>
